Buying Guide: Key Considerations for Metal Drilling
- Material composition: Cobalt (M35 or M42 variants) enhances heat resistance and hardness, improving cutting life in hardened metals and stainless steel.
- Tip geometry: Split-point tips reduce walking and provide precise starts; three-flute designs improve chip removal and smoother cutting in thicker materials.
- Coatings: TiN or TiAlN coatings lower friction and heat buildup, extending bit life and maintaining sharpness during repeated drilling.
- Shank type: Ensure compatibility with your drill chuck or impact driver; hex shanks and three-flat shanks help with bit retention and alignment.
- Set range vs. specialty: Larger sets offer breadth for many tasks; specialized sets target high-precision metalwork with particular alloy types.
- Storage and organization: A durable, labeled storage case helps prevent loss and enables quick tool retrieval on site.
- Application scope: For home or shop use, consider whether you need a broad set for many metals or a focused set optimized for stainless steel and hardened alloys.
